I'd say it's not worth it. you can spend to $40 on something much better, like Guilty Gear X... don't take me wrong, it's a fabulous fighting game when you take into consideration that it's a fan-made game. However that's just what it is, a truly great fan-made game, but nowhere near the quality of some good commercial game. $40 is too much IMO, it's definitely worth playing for some time, mainly for the single player part, however the lack of character balance means that it's not that good if you want to play against some friends, so it doesn't last as long as other good fighting games.

Also it's very text-heavy despite the fact that it's a fighting game, expect a lot of reading through the single player mode.

IMO, if you are a hardcore Tsukihime fan, buy it for sure, in that case you'd have already bought it by now... if you are only somewhat interested in the Tsukihime universe, it may not worth the $40... if you are a fan of fighting games, there are definitely better games to spend the $40 on.

Search around in the "Shingetsutan Tsukihime," previous "MELTY BLOOD," and to a certain extent "Queen of Hearts 98/99" and you will find numerous that I wrote regarding this collaborated doujin game. If the info inspires your interest, then I recommend it - if it doesn't then I won't. The main reason here is that the whole TYPE-MOON world is "love-it-or-hate-it" kind of story. Granted TYPE-MOON went pro and released one of the best selling ero-games out there this year, it's doujin game "Tsukihime" was a very polar game in a sense where some people love the in-depth story and amateurish art while others hate it for the long text and amateurish art.

Since MELTY BLOOD is a doujin game, it is not sold in Amazon. The link refer you to in Amazon is the "MELTY BLOOD Gaming Guide" which lists all the moves and the story walkthrough. Hence, since it is published book, you can probably get Amazon to ship it to your country.

I should inform you that MELTY BLOOD ReACT has been delayed by another month. If you go to the-now-defunct-Watanabe-Seisakujo-website's online diary (http://www2s.biglobe.ne.jp/~k_wata/zaki.htm), Narita-san apologized that MELTY BLOOD ReACT will not be done for release at C-Revo (which is on April 29th). Excuse: "I didn't plan ahead well that it was going to be this hard..." "This will be our first two-disc game" etc etc. Conclusion: it has been delayed for at least a month, and hope to see it on a May release (hopefully).

A full FAQ and movelist can be found at GameFAQs. The "fire-girl" is Akiha, and her 300% EX attack is Sekishu Origami. You do it the same way you do almost every 300% EX attack--roll the controller 180º from back to down to forwards, and hit strong attack. Only while your magic circuit is at 300%, of course.
